Scout Report

The pressure cooker of Montverde Academy isn't for everyone. Yet, when you see a prospect like Oneal Delancy, who's not only surviving but thriving in that environment as a 2027 recruit, you take notice. His comfort level playing alongside some of the nation's premier talent speaks volumes about his poise and immediate impact.

Background

Delancy comes from Montverde, Florida, which means he's grown up in the shadow of one of the country's most dominant prep basketball programs. His development within Montverde's system, a program known for its demanding practices and high-level competition, has clearly accelerated his growth. Playing alongside future college stars like Cornelius Ingram Jr., Hudson Greer, and Dante Allen provides a unique proving ground, forcing Delancy to elevate his game daily against players often older and more physically developed. This daily grind against top talent helps forge a player who understands the pace and physicality required to compete at the collegiate level.

Playing Style

Oneal Delancy operates primarily as a combo guard, with a keen offensive mind that belies his youth. He possesses excellent off-ball movement, constantly relocating to create passing lanes or open looks, demonstrating a high basketball IQ that allows him to integrate seamlessly into complex offenses. His decision-making with the ball is generally sound, particularly in catch-and-shoot scenarios where he's quick to assess and fire. While not a primary ball-handler at Montverde, his ability to step into that role for stretches, manage tempo, and initiate offense is certainly present. Defensively, he puts in effort and shows good lateral quickness, particularly when guarding on the perimeter. His impact extends beyond scoring; he understands spacing and how to leverage his shooting threat to open up opportunities for teammates, making him an invaluable piece on the offensive end.

Strengths

Delancy’s jump shot is his most apparent and significant asset, a legitimate weapon that can change the complexion of a game. He has a quick, repeatable release, showing comfort and consistency from beyond the arc, whether coming off screens or spotting up in transition. His range extends well past the college three-point line, forcing defenders to guard him tightly as soon as he crosses half-court. This shooting prowess makes him an immediate floor-spacer, alleviating pressure on interior scorers and creating driving lanes for his teammates. He understands how to use screens effectively to gain separation, showcasing a maturity in his offensive approach rarely seen in someone his age.

Areas to Watch

To truly unlock the next layer of his potential, Delancy needs to continue developing his on-ball creation and secondary playmaking. Refining his handle against tight pressure and diversifying his attack off the dribble will be crucial for him to transition from a strong scorer to a primary offensive initiator. Increased strength and physicality will also help him absorb contact on drives and improve his defensive versatility, allowing him to guard multiple positions as he progresses through high school and into college.

Player Comparison

There's a developing resemblance in his game to a young Luke Kennard. Similar to Kennard, Delancy has an innate feel for scoring, especially from range, and displays a polished offensive approach as a wing guard. Both players excel at finding their spots off the ball and possess the smooth shooting stroke to capitalize, offering a consistent threat from deep. The comparison lies in their offensive polish and ability to contribute significantly without dominating the ball, rather than raw athleticism or primary facilitating duties.

Recruitment

Delancy's recruitment is already a fierce battle, with 22 Division 1 offers pouring in from programs like Florida State, Houston, LSU, Maryland, Miami, South Florida, Cincinnati, and Florida. His early national ranking at #56 for the 2027 class, combined with his Montverde pedigree, positions him as a priority target for high-major programs across the country. Given his youth, there's no rush to commit, allowing him to thoroughly evaluate his options over the next few years. Expect top-tier schools to continue their pursuit, with a decision likely not coming until well into his junior or senior year, as he continues to develop his game and build relationships with coaching staffs.

Projection

Oneal Delancy projects as a high-major starter, capable of providing instant offense and floor spacing for a college program. His shooting ability alone guarantees him a significant role at the next level, likely as a primary perimeter threat who demands defensive attention. Should he continue to expand his offensive repertoire and add strength, his trajectory points towards an intriguing professional path, potentially as a reliable scoring guard who can contribute efficiently from the perimeter.
